- [ ] **Step 7: Breaker override escrow.** After sealing the signing keys for the Tallgrove upstream API circuit breaker, confirm the support team can force the breaker open during a full outage. The override bundle lives in the sealed escrow drawer and is useless without its unlock phrase. Two ceremony witnesses must initial this step before proceeding. The escrow bundle is decrypted with the recovery passphrase that follows.

vault phrase of kahip-kahop = holath-quenmir

# Break-Glass: Catalog Cache Invalidation

Scope: the Pinrow product catalog at Veldstone Retail. If stale prices persist after a purge and the Hollowmere invalidation queue is wedged, use break-glass to flush the edge tier directly. Contractors: get verbal sign-off from the catalog lead first. Steps: open the Hollowmere admin shell, select emergency-flush, confirm the tenant, and run it once — repeated flushes thrash the origin. Access is logged and expires after 20 minutes. Unseal the admin shell with the passphrase below.

recovery phrase for kahop-tajog: istix-casvan

**Q: How do I cut over the Ledgerfox billing worker during a blue-green deploy?**

A: Drain the green pool first, verify invoice checksums match across both environments, then flip the Tollgate router. Never flip mid-billing-cycle without confirming the reconciliation job has finished. If the router refuses the flip, unlock it with the recovery passphrase below.

recovery phrase for bafof-kajof: quenmir-ralmir-praeth

**Q: Why are Quillbeam handlers taking 4–8 seconds on the first request?**

That's a cold start — the runtime spins up a fresh worker after ~10 minutes idle. It's expected, not an incident, unless p95 latency stays elevated after warm-up. Mitigations: enable the pre-warm pool in the Fennel console, or bump min-instances for hot paths. Don't page the platform team for isolated cold starts overnight. If cold starts persist past three consecutive invocations, open a ticket and loop in the runtime crew at this address.

alerts address for kajog-tadup: druox@plorvanet.internal